Captain Phasma might be one of the most visually striking villains in the “Star Wars” saga thanks to her polished metal armor. But according to the official visual dictionary of “The Force Awakens,” it, too, is a prequel reference. Her armor was crafted from the hull of a Naboo starship once owned by Emperor Palpatine. Remember the silver ships Padme and Anakin used to criss-crossed the galaxy? Now every time you look at Captain Phasma, you’ll be reminded of that more elegant time in spacefaring.
